Cancer-related health behaviors during the COVID 19 pandemic in geographically diverse samples across the US
Abstract Background The COVID-19 pandemic involved business closures (e.g., gyms), social distancing policies, and prolonged stressful situations that may have impacted engagement in health behaviors.
